Reservoir Pond
Reservoir Pond is a public boat ramp on Reservoir Pond near Townsend, Wisconsin. This beginner-level spot offers kayaking, canoeing, paddleboarding. Amenities include boat ramp, parking. Best visited in summer.

About This Location
Launch into Reservoir Pond near Townsend, Wisconsin. Beginner level with calm and sheltered water.
Reservoir Pond is a public access point on Reservoir Pond in Wisconsin, giving paddlers a convenient entry to the lake.
This is a solid spot for kayaking, with enough room to settle into a comfortable paddling rhythm. Canoeing works well here, especially for those looking for a peaceful day on the water. Great Lakes paddling combines freshwater vastness with coastal-style conditions and scenery.
Expect calm and sheltered conditions on the water. The best time to visit is June through August. Facilities include boat ramp and parking.
Reservoir Pond sits about 5 min from Townsend, making it a convenient option for local and visiting paddlers.
